A Prayer for Restoration and Deliverance

"Beerah his son, whom Tilgath-pilneser king of Assyria carried away captive: he was prince of the Reubenites." - 1 Chronicles 5:6

O Lord God Almighty, we come before You today with humble hearts, acknowledging Your sovereignty over all creation. As we reflect on the words of 1 Chronicles 5:6, "Beerah his son, whom Tilgath-pilneser king of Assyria carried away captive: he was prince of the Reubenites," we are reminded of the trials and tribulations that your chosen people endured. The captivity experienced by Beerah and the Reubenites speaks to us of the painful separations and losses we sometimes encounter in our own lives.

Heavenly Father, we recognize that this story, though set in ancient history, holds profound lessons for us today. Just as Beerah was taken from his people and brought to a foreign land, many of us face circumstances that feel akin to captivity—whether it be through addiction, strife, loss, or despair. We lift up before You those amongst us who feel ensnared by their circumstances, who long for freedom and restoration. May they experience Your divine intervention in their lives, and may they feel Your presence in their darkest moments.

Lord, we know from Scripture that You are the God of liberation and restoration. We ask that You look upon those who are burdened and weary, those who feel they have been carried away by the trials of life, just as Beerah was carried away captive. Reach out to them with Your mighty hand and rescue them from their bondage. Fill them with hope and assure them that they are not alone. Remind us all that even in the fiercest battles, You walk with us, and that Your plan for each of us is one of hope and a future.

Gracious Father, we pray for those who feel powerless and isolated. Help them to understand that their worth is not determined by their circumstances but by their identity as Your beloved children. Like Beerah, we may find ourselves in positions of difficulty, but we can be comforted by the knowledge that You have a purpose for us. Strengthen our faith, that we may trust in your promises, even when our sight is clouded by despair.

We also bring before You our leaders, those in positions of authority within our communities, churches, and nations. Just as the prince of the Reubenites had influence and leadership, we pray that they would seek Your wisdom in their governance. Raise up leaders who will champion justice, compassion, and integrity, allowing Your light to shine brightly through their actions. May they protect the vulnerable and stand firm against the forces that seek to separate and divide.

Father, as we enter into a season of seeking Your guidance, we request a spirit of unity among us. Help us to come together, as Your body, to offer love and support to those who are struggling with feelings of displacement—both spiritually and emotionally. Let us not forget that we are called to be Your hands and feet in this world, to help those who are captive find freedom and belonging in You.

In our prayer today, we also acknowledge that we may, at times, be the ones who carry others away through judgment, neglect, or apathy. Forgive us for the moments we have failed to embody Your love. Cleanse our hearts and help us to extend grace to those around us. May we be bridges rather than barriers, sowing seeds of reconciliation and understanding.

Lord, You are our refuge and strength, a present help in times of trouble. We thank You for the grace that sustains us and the hope that anchors our souls. Teach us to rely on Your unfailing love, just as the Reubenites, in their captivity, had to trust in Your deliverance. May we continually seek Your face, and through every high and low, may we testify to Your faithfulness.

In the name of Jesus, who brings healing and restoration, we pray. Amen.
